Your Role in the Community:
  • Support with daily living:
    Personal care, medication assistance, meal preparation, and general support
  • Build meaningful relationships:
    Offer companionship and conversation, provide emotional support, and help people feel safe and respected in their own homes
  • Promote independence:
    Enable individuals to live confidently and comfortably within the PL5 area
